The Science Behind Freeze-Drying

Before delving into the applications of freeze-dried powder in the nutraceutical industry, it’s essential to understand the science behind the freeze-drying process. Freeze-drying, also known as lyophilization, is a method of preserving biological materials by removing water through sublimation. The process involves freezing the material at extremely low temperatures and then subjecting it to a vacuum, which causes the ice to turn directly into vapor without passing through the liquid phase.

This gentle process preserves the structure, flavor, and nutritional content of the material, making it an ideal method for preserving sensitive ingredients such as vitamins, minerals, enzymes, and bioactive compounds. By removing the water, freeze-drying also extends the shelf life of the product, reduces its weight, and makes it easier to store and transport.

Applications of Freeze-Dried Powder in the Nutraceutical Industry

Dietary Supplements

One of the most significant applications of freeze-dried powder in the nutraceutical industry is in the production of dietary supplements. Freeze-dried powders can be used to encapsulate a wide range of nutrients, including vitamins, minerals, herbs, and botanicals, providing a convenient and effective way to deliver these nutrients to the body.

For example, freeze-dried powders of fruits and vegetables are commonly used in dietary supplements to provide a concentrated source of vitamins, antioxidants, and other bioactive compounds. These powders can be easily incorporated into capsules, tablets, or powders, making them a popular choice for consumers looking to boost their nutrient intake.

Functional Foods and Beverages

Freeze-dried powders are also widely used in the production of functional foods and beverages. Functional foods are foods that provide health benefits beyond basic nutrition, while functional beverages are beverages that contain added ingredients to enhance their health-promoting properties.

Freeze-dried powders can be used to add flavor, color, and nutritional value to functional foods and beverages. For example, freeze-dried powders of berries, such as blueberries and strawberries, can be added to smoothies, yogurt, and cereal to provide a rich source of antioxidants and other bioactive compounds. Similarly, freeze-dried powders of herbs and botanicals, such as ginseng and green tea, can be added to beverages to provide a natural source of energy and other health benefits.

Sports Nutrition

In the sports nutrition industry, freeze-dried powders are used to provide athletes with a convenient and effective way to replenish their energy and nutrients during and after exercise. Freeze-dried powders of protein, carbohydrates, and electrolytes are commonly used in sports drinks, protein bars, and other sports nutrition products.

These powders are designed to be easily absorbed by the body, providing a quick and efficient source of energy and nutrients. They can also help to reduce muscle soreness and fatigue, improve recovery time, and enhance athletic performance.

Cosmeceuticals

Freeze-dried powders are also used in the production of cosmeceuticals, which are cosmetic products that have therapeutic or medicinal properties. Freeze-dried powders of natural ingredients, such as plant extracts and essential oils, can be used to formulate skincare products, such as creams, lotions, and serums.

These powders can provide a range of benefits for the skin, including moisturization, anti-aging, and anti-inflammatory effects. They can also help to improve the texture and appearance of the skin, making it look smoother, firmer, and more youthful.

Advantages of Using Freeze-Dried Powder in the Nutraceutical Industry

Preservation of Nutritional Value

One of the main advantages of using freeze-dried powder in the nutraceutical industry is the preservation of nutritional value. The freeze-drying process helps to retain the structure, flavor, and nutritional content of the material, ensuring that the nutrients are not lost during processing.

This is particularly important for sensitive ingredients, such as vitamins, minerals, and enzymes, which can be easily degraded by heat, light, and oxygen. By using freeze-dried powders, nutraceutical manufacturers can ensure that their products contain the highest quality and most effective ingredients.

Shelf Life Extension

Another advantage of using freeze-dried powder in the nutraceutical industry is the extension of shelf life. The removal of water through the freeze-drying process helps to prevent the growth of microorganisms and the degradation of the product, making it more stable and less prone to spoilage.

This means that nutraceutical products containing freeze-dried powders can have a longer shelf life, reducing the need for preservatives and other additives. It also makes it easier to store and transport the products, as they do not require refrigeration or special storage conditions.
